19 Jul Are smart contracts taking over the world? What are the advantages and disadvantages?
Many people are of the view that, like artificial intelligence, smart contracts are going to take over our lives and relegate “traditional” or “paper” contracts to history. How likely is this to happen? In our view, smart contracts have a role to pay but there will always be a need for “paper” agreements. The “smartness” of a smart contract is determined by the methodology used to regulate transactions and the quality of its coding. They are well suited for environments that entail high volumes of transactions in finance, digital goods or digital workflow procedures like supply chains. They are not applicable in many areas that rely on performances that cannot be digitally regulated.
According to Wikipedia “smart contracts” were first proposed in the early 1990s by Nick Szabo, computer scientist, cryptographer, and lawyer. He coined the term, using it to refer to “a set of promises, specified in digital form, including protocols within which the parties perform on these promises”. The concept has arisen with blockchain technology before crypto currencies or assets became common place.
Attraction.
Smart contracts consist of two equally important parts. Firstly, the computer code set, and secondly, the relevant data. The code manages the functionality of the contract while the data manages the conditions and performance. These smart contract components are located at a specific address in a blockchain. They therefore provide functionality that goes beyond traditional or “paper ” contracts.
The attractiveness of these contracts is that they facilitate the automatic exchange of value. They do not require banks, governments, or intermediaries to guarantee contract adherence.
Functionality.
The functionality of a smart contract at a very basic level can be as follows:
Step 1:
Terms are agreed between parties regarding the execution of defined actions upon the occurrence of defined trigger events. These are hard coded into a digital contract located in a blockchain (public or private).
Step 2:
The first in a series of trigger events occurs, such as the receipt of an order for goods. The code initiates the programmed action, being the automatic shipment of the goods for example. The act of shipment triggers another event which is the payment for the goods.
These contracts therefore function in the same way as a “paper” agreement, yet the performance is rendered digitally. They operate like the “IF ” functionality in Excel, namely “if – then”. The requirement is that the “if ” and the “then” information must be digitally available without human intervention.
The concept behind these contracts is not new. There are many software solutions that facilitate similar functionality, particularly in financial transactions. See for example the payment guarantee solution offered by G-Pay (https://www.gpay.co.za/). The difference is the fact that smart contracts are based a distributed ledger blockchain technology such as Ethereum, Cardano, and Hyperledger Fabric. This means that there is a non-centralised, immutable record of the contract and its execution that is in the public domain. It does not reside in a database controlled by one of the parties or a service provider.
The main similarities and differences between smart contracts and paper contracts are:
Advantages of smart contracts:
- Transparency: As these contracts are hosted on the decentralised blockchain, there is complete transparency. All transactions are therefore within the public domain and are easy verifiable.
- The Terms of Operation are Immutable: The terms of the contract cannot be changed meaning that no-one can interfere with the operation of the contract resulting in non-performance or theft.
- Economic Efficiency: They can make businesses with high levels of transaction processing and monitoring more efficient and eliminate loss due to human error, fraud or theft. They do not require intermediaries such as lawyers, bankers and intermediaries. The code is writ ten once, which is then used whenever needed.
- Greater level of trust: The contract is implemented automatically and does not require the input of anyone for it to be executed. This eliminates human error and the opportunity for non-performance.
- Secure storage and backup: The risks associated with the security and maintenance of transaction data. As the contracts and performance is recorded on the distributed blockchain servers and there is no risk of it being lost.
- Fraud prevention: Properly coded smart contracts allow no chance for unauthorized access to the system that prevents fraud.
Disadvantages of smart contracts:
- Security: The technology is relatively new which means that gaps may be found and exploited.
- Risks for complex transactions: Gartner is of the view that smart contracts with multiple parties may create problems with their manageability and scalability.
- Immutability: The fact that once the contracts have been created, they cannot be changed can be problematic if the circumstances change and contract terms require amendment or the workflow processes change.
- Currency: Smart contracts are settled using a crypto currency and cannot be settled in fiat currency.
Smart contracts have benefits and advantages but in our view, are not appropriate in all circumstances.
